The couple, along with Peter Hodge and Becki Yu, will take part Camp Quality’s wesCarpade fundraising trip in a Wizard of Oz-themed car tomorrow.

Mrs Sangalli said the week-long Outback journey was on her bucket list, and would be their first adventure without their three children in 12 years.

‘All of them have been blessed and very healthy (but) they all have had friends that have had to go through the cancer battle,’ she said.

Mrs Sangalli said they had already exceeded their fundraising target of $5000, with many local residents and businesses donating about $6500 by Tuesday.

They have modified their vehicle, a 1983 Statesman de Ville, by adding bash plates underneath, working on the motor and changing its tyres.

As part of the third annual wesCarpade, about 25 cars will travel off road from Kalbarri to Dampier between August 3 and 9.
